At the 2026 China Automotive Chongqing Forum held from June 12th to 13th, Ling Heping, Vice President of BYD's Automotive Engineering Research Institute, delivered a speech.
Ling Heping discussed how Byd Company Limited (ASX: 002594)'s flash charging technology, along with its own station construction, has played a significant guiding role in sustaining the rapid growth of the new energy vehicle sector. Furthermore, the underlying energy storage solutions may offer new approaches for fields like chip manufacturing.
He illustrated this by stating that Byd Company Limited (ASX: 002594) has integrated its energy storage technology into the flash charging system. This energy storage technology can make the entire power supply exceptionally stable. The processes of chip manufacturing and the development of large-scale models also have substantial demands for stable power and electricity supply. Therefore, the relevant expertise accumulated in flash charging technology can also significantly contribute to power supply stability in the chip manufacturing domain.
"For charging at such high power levels, relying entirely on the grid would be unsustainable. By introducing energy storage, Byd Company Limited (ASX: 002594) has greatly improved the utilization efficiency of the entire grid," he mentioned.
He noted that with the advancement of intelligent driving and the widespread application of computing chips and large models, electricity demand is continuously increasing. Byd Company Limited's (ASX: 002594) flash charging-related technologies precisely address this issue of power supply capacity.
Additionally, Ling Heping emphasized that this technology has generated multiple spillover effects. Much like how the new energy vehicle industry drives the development of the entire semiconductor sector, flash charging technology itself, while propelling the growth of new energy vehicles, also stimulates downstream industries and provides new solutions for the chip manufacturing field.
